§ 20-20-17-6

Ask AI about this
The department may award grants to school corporations:(1) upon review of the applications received under section 5 of this chapter;(2) subject to available money; and(3) in accordance with the following priorities:(A) To the extent possible, to achieve geographic balance throughout Indiana and to include urban, suburban, and rural school corporations.(B) To address a documented need for new or expanded school intervention or career counseling programs, including considering the percentage of students within the school corporation who are designated as at risk students.(C) To promote innovative methods for initiating or expanding school intervention or career counseling programs.(D) To reward school corporations that propose school intervention or career counseling programs that demonstrate the greatest potential for replication and implementation in Indiana.(E) To lower school counselor/student ratios where the ratios are excessively high.[Pre-2005 Elementary and Secondary Education Recodification Citation: 20-10.1-28-6.]As added by P.L.1-2005, SEC.4. Amended by P.L.286-2013, SEC.36.
